The reason this clue has the answer "ADAMS" is because it refers to one of the prominent leaders of the Boston Tea Party, which took place on December 16, 1773. The Boston Tea Party was a significant event in American history, where a group of American colonists, known as the Sons of Liberty, dressed as Native Americans and dumped several chests of tea into the Boston Harbor as a protest against British taxation.

There were two famous Adams who played crucial roles during this time period: John Adams and Samuel Adams. While John Adams went on to become the second President of the United States, Samuel Adams was one of the key leaders of the revolutionary movement. In the context of the clue, "Boston Tea Party leader," it is specifically referring to Samuel Adams.

Samuel Adams was a vocal advocate for American independence and played a pivotal role in organizing and orchestrating the Boston Tea Party. He was a staunch anti-British colonial leader and one of the founding fathers of the United States. His leadership and activism earned him a prominent place in American history.
